Dual Hybrid Powertrains for Every Driver

Under the hood, the 2026 Crown offers two sophisticated hybrid options, both paired with standard all-wheel drive for confident handling in various conditions.

  • The standard hybrid combines a 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ine with electric motors to produce 236 net horsepower, delivering smooth acceleration and impressive efficiency.
  • The Hybrid MAX setup, exclusive to the top Platinum trim, features a turbocharged 2.4-liter engine and additional electric assistance for a robust 340 horsepower output.
  • Both systems prioritize seamless power delivery, with the base hybrid achieving up to 42 mpg city and 41 mpg highway estimates.
  • The Platinum’s six-speed automatic transmission provides a more engaging feel compared to the CVT in lower trims.

This powertrain strategy lets buyers choose between maximum efficiency for daily commutes or added punch for spirited drives.

Luxurious Interior Crafted for Comfort

Step inside, and the Crown feels worlds apart from typical Toyota offerings. Premium materials cover the seats, dashboard, and door panels, with leather-trimmed heated and ventilated front seats standard even on the entry-level XLE. The cabin provides generous space for five passengers, enhanced by thoughtful touches like a panoramic roof option and available heated rear seats. Technology takes center stage with dual 12.3-inch screens—one for the digital instrument cluster and one for the infotainment system—supporting w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. Drivers appreciate the intuitive layout, clear graphics, and features like a head-up display on higher trims that keep eyes on the road.

Advanced Features and Safety Across the Lineup

Toyota equips every Crown with a comprehensive suite of driver-assistance technologies. Adaptive cruise control, lane-keeping assist, and automatic emergency braking come standard, working together to make highway trips less stressful. Higher trims add extras such as a panoramic view monitor, advanced park assist, and adaptive dampers for a more refined ride. The Nightshade trim brings a sportier edge with unique wheels and blacked-out elements, while the Platinum focuses on ultimate refinement.

FAQs

What makes the 2026 Toyota Crown different from previous models?

The latest version builds on its unique elevated sedan design with refined trim distinctions, bolder styling elements like the Nightshade edition, and consistent focus on hybrid performance across all grades.

How efficient is the 2026 Toyota Crown?

The standard hybrid powertrain delivers strong fuel economy, with estimates reaching up to 42 mpg in the city and 41 mpg on the highway, while the more powerful Hybrid MAX still achieves around 29-32 mpg combined.

Does the 2026 Crown come with all-wheel drive?

Yes, every trim level includes standard all-wheel drive, enhancing traction and stability in rain, snow, or uneven roads.

What trim levels are available for the 2026 Toyota Crown?

Buyers can choose from XLE, Limited, Nightshade, and Platinum, each offering progressively more premium features, unique styling cues, and powertrain options.

Is the 2026 Crown a good choice for luxury buyers on a budget?

Absolutely—it delivers near-luxury materials, advanced tech, and strong performance at a price point that undercuts many traditional luxury sedans while maintaining Toyota’s reputation for reliability.
